Runbook: Chalkwright timetable solver, nightly run. The solver pulls room and staff constraints from the Penhallow registry, then writes candidate schedules to the review queue. If a run exceeds 20 minutes, it exits cleanly and retries once with relaxed soft constraints. Reviewers should check the constraint-weights module before approving changes to defaults. The solver boots with the configuration shown directly below.

deployment values, kajep-kageg:
[praix]
host = praix.paliqcorp.corp
user = praix_svc
database = praix_prod

**Ticket: replica-lag alarm drifting again (Burrowdeck)**

So the read-replica lag alarm on the Burrowdeck cluster fired all weekend for lag we'd normally shrug at. Turns out someone hand-tweaked the threshold and evaluation window on two of the four monitor hosts back in March, and they've been quietly diverging since. Future maintainers: please don't edit these on-box — it never gets back into the repo. I've reconciled everything to one source of truth; the canonical alarm settings are as follows.

service settings:
PRAWYN_PIN=9848
PRAWYN_METRICS_HOST=metrics.prawyn.lumicworks.corp
PRAWYN_LOG_LEVEL=warn
PRAWYN_TENANT=pelius

Before promoting a build of the Tallyforge conversion engine, run the rounding-drift suite against the staging rate tables. Pay close attention to currencies with three decimal places; historical incidents (see the Quivermark postmortem) stemmed from truncation applied before the final rounding step. If drift exceeds 0.005 units per thousand conversions, halt the release and page the pricing team. The drift checker authenticates against the internal RateSentry service, and you will need its credential to run it.

gateway credential: kto3_qfe

**Vendor note: Inkmill markdown pipeline**

Rendering for Parchway docs is outsourced to Inkmill under an annual contract, renewing each March. They handle sanitization and PDF export; we own the upload queue. SLA: 4-hour response on rendering failures. Escalate only after two failed retries. Their support desk is reachable at the address below.

billing contact of hahaf-baguf = zorael.tammir.jorius@sivrelhq.internal